"Food: 5 Service: 5 Atmosphere: 5"
Phone: +34965993307,+34691073383
Address: Calle Orquideas Nº 10, Orihuela, Spain
City: Orihuela
Website: https://surfersbar.net
Monday: 09:30 -22:00
Tuesday: 09:30 -22:00
Wednesday: 09:30 -22:00
Thursday: 09:30 -22:00
Friday: 09:30 -22:00
Saturday: 09:30 -22:00
Sunday: 09:30 -22:00
Dishes: 14
Amenities: 17
Categories: 5
Reviews: 8806